The ultra miniature RF312 is designed to improve upon the RF300 relay’s high frequency performance. The RF312 offers monotonic insertion loss to 8 GHz. This improvement in RF insertion loss over the frequency range, makes these relays highly suitable for use in attenuator and other RF circuits. • High repeatability.
• Broader bandwidth.
• Metal enclosure for EMI shielding.
• Ground pin option to improve case grounding.
• High isolation between control and signal paths.
• Highly resistant to ESD.
CONSTRUCTION FEATURES
The following unique construction features and manufacturing techniques provide excellent resistance to environmental extremes and overall reliability.
• Uni-frame motor design provides high magnetic efficiency and mechanical rigidity.
• Minimum mass components and welded construction provide maximum resistance to shock and vibration.
